使用jQuery模拟圆形鼠标移动?

时间:2014-11-21 19:28:39

标签: javascript jquery mouseevent parallax

有没有办法让鼠标光标使用jQuery以圆形形式重复移动?

将用于测试{/ 3}在GPU / CPU上的负载。

1 个答案:

答案 0 :(得分:2)

无法使用Javascript控制用户鼠标。这背后的意图是防止点击劫持和游标劫持。请考虑以下情形:

  

1)用户点击链接。
  2)Javascript强制鼠标在点击之前移动到另一个链接   3)用户最终点击包含大量NSFW内容的链接并被解雇。

另外,从Cookieclicker

的角度考虑另一种情况
  

1)用户将光标自动化脚本注入控制台   2)用户无需单击即可继续玩游戏。


光标控制的替代

但是,您可以查找可以模拟事件的框架的Javascript页面自动化测试,而不是移动鼠标光标的方法;包括光标移动。 This 是第三方应用程序,可以为您控制鼠标。您还可以将jQuery trigger用于在origin-x or y更改时触发的自定义事件。

  

视差引擎,它对智能设备的方向做出反应。   没有陀螺仪或运动检测硬件的地方,   改为使用光标的位置。

我们从它的文档中看到,Parallax是一个对游标事件做出反应的库。此外,从我看来,似乎光标位置被转换为origin-xorigin-y输入;两个值的默认值均为0.5(视口的中心),x - 0为左,1为右,y - 0为顶部,1为底部。不是为光标创建自动化,而是自动化这些值以模拟某些运动所需的输入。